If you haven't read President Uchtdorf's entire lesson yet, I wanted to share with you the last paragraph.
"...the work of patience boils down to this: keep the commandments; trust in God, our Heavenly Father; serve Him with meekness and Christlike love; exercise faith and hope in the Savior; and never give up. The lessons we learn from patience will cultivate our character, lift our lives, and heighten our happiness."
I especially like the "never give up" part. I also liked Rose Hutchison's comment in the meeting when she said she taught her children that patience meant "to wait and be happy."
